Factors Affecting Fire Ratings for Commercial Doors

When selecting commercial doors, understanding fire ratings is critical. Various factors affect these ratings. Material composition plays a significant role, influencing how long a door can withstand flames. Steel doors typically offer superior fire resistance compared to wooden counterparts. According to the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A), up to 70% of fire-related deaths occur in structures with inadequate fire barriers.

Another significant factor is the door's construction. Hollow-core doors, for instance, may provide lower ratings than solid-core models. The rating system divides doors into classes based on their performance in fire resistance tests. These ratings can influence insurance premiums as well. Higher-rated doors might reduce costs in certain scenarios, as they demonstrate greater protection.

Choosing the Right Fire-Rated Door for Your Business Needs

Choosing the right fire-rated door for your business is crucial. Fire-rated doors serve as barriers to control fire and smoke spread. They are essential in protecting life and property. According to a National Fire Protection Association report, about 3,000 deaths occur annually due to fires. Insufficient fire protection in commercial spaces contributes significantly to these statistics.

Consider your specific needs. Different buildings have varying requirements based on occupancy and type of business. Fire ratings typically range from 20 to 120 minutes. A door rated for 60 minutes may be suitable for offices. However, high-risk areas, like factories, often need doors rated higher than 90 minutes. You must assess your situation carefully.
